欢迎来到天天文库
浏览记录
ID:38196274
大小:280.51 KB
页数:4页
时间:2019-05-25
《Spring下mybatis多数据源配置》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、Spring下mybatis多数据源配置介绍本文描述了以mybatis作为持久层框架使用Spring的声明式事务时,如何配置多个数据源(即连接多个数据库),使用Spring的注解方式迚行依赖的注入和事务的管理。并且利用mybatis的spring插件自动扫描和装配Mapper接口。先来看一个mybatis的单数据源配置2、ogicalcobwebs.proxool.ProxoolDataSource">3、name="houseKeepingTestSql"value="${house-keeping-test-sql}"/>4、-count}"/>5、urce"ref="dataSource"/>6、nsaction-manager="transactionManager"/>说明1.数据库连接池使用Proxool,首先配置的就是Proxool的数据源2.接下来配置Spring的声明式事务管理,这里我们使用全注7、解+自动装配的方式迚行Bena和事务声明。3.mybatis配置为自动扫描Maper接口,只要指定Mapper接口所在的包,需要注意的是,Mapper接口对应的映射文件(.xml)也要在这个包里,且名字和接口的名字一致。使用多个数据源时,mybatis的文档表示丌能使用自动扫描和自动装配,但实际使用时发现还是可以的。看一个配置文件先:8、="dataSource"class="org.logicalcobwebs.proxool.ProxoolDataSource">
2、ogicalcobwebs.proxool.ProxoolDataSource">3、name="houseKeepingTestSql"value="${house-keeping-test-sql}"/>4、-count}"/>5、urce"ref="dataSource"/>6、nsaction-manager="transactionManager"/>说明1.数据库连接池使用Proxool,首先配置的就是Proxool的数据源2.接下来配置Spring的声明式事务管理,这里我们使用全注7、解+自动装配的方式迚行Bena和事务声明。3.mybatis配置为自动扫描Maper接口,只要指定Mapper接口所在的包,需要注意的是,Mapper接口对应的映射文件(.xml)也要在这个包里,且名字和接口的名字一致。使用多个数据源时,mybatis的文档表示丌能使用自动扫描和自动装配,但实际使用时发现还是可以的。看一个配置文件先:8、="dataSource"class="org.logicalcobwebs.proxool.ProxoolDataSource">
3、name="houseKeepingTestSql"value="${house-keeping-test-sql}"/>4、-count}"/>5、urce"ref="dataSource"/>
4、-count}"/>5、urce"ref="dataSource"/>
5、urce"ref="dataSource"/>
6、nsaction-manager="transactionManager"/>说明1.数据库连接池使用Proxool,首先配置的就是Proxool的数据源2.接下来配置Spring的声明式事务管理,这里我们使用全注
7、解+自动装配的方式迚行Bena和事务声明。3.mybatis配置为自动扫描Maper接口,只要指定Mapper接口所在的包,需要注意的是,Mapper接口对应的映射文件(.xml)也要在这个包里,且名字和接口的名字一致。使用多个数据源时,mybatis的文档表示丌能使用自动扫描和自动装配,但实际使用时发现还是可以的。看一个配置文件先:8、="dataSource"class="org.logicalcobwebs.proxool.ProxoolDataSource">
8、="dataSource"class="org.logicalcobwebs.proxool.ProxoolDataSource">
此文档下载收益归作者所有